Overview of Family Service Counselor

Family Service Counselors are professionals who provide support and guidance to families in need. They work to improve family functioning and promote positive outcomes for children, adults, and seniors. This role involves assessing family needs, developing intervention plans, and providing counseling services to address issues such as mental health, substance abuse, and domestic violence.
Family Service Counselors also collaborate with other professionals, such as social workers, psychologists, and healthcare providers, to ensure that families receive comprehensive support. They may work in a variety of settings, including schools, hospitals, community centers, and private practices. The goal of a Family Service Counselor is to help families overcome challenges and achieve stability and well-being.

About Family Service Counselor Resume

A Family Service Counselor resume should highlight the candidate's education, training, and experience in family counseling and support. It should also emphasize their ability to assess family needs, develop intervention plans, and provide counseling services. The resume should include relevant certifications, such as a license in social work or counseling, as well as any specialized training in areas such as mental health, substance abuse, or domestic violence.
In addition to professional qualifications, a Family Service Counselor resume should showcase the candidate's interpersonal skills, such as empathy, communication, and problem-solving. It should also highlight their ability to work collaboratively with other professionals and community organizations to provide comprehensive support to families.

Introduction to Family Service Counselor Resume Interests

A Family Service Counselor resume interests section should reflect the candidate's passion for helping families and their commitment to the field of family counseling. It should include any relevant volunteer work, community service, or advocacy efforts that demonstrate the candidate's dedication to improving family well-being.
The interests section should also highlight any hobbies or activities that demonstrate the candidate's ability to connect with others and build relationships. For example, interests in parenting, education, or community service could be relevant for a Family Service Counselor role. The goal of the interests section is to provide a well-rounded picture of the candidate's personality and values, and to demonstrate their fit for the role.
